在linux系统中,有多种方法可以查看正在运行的程序,以下是一些常用的方法:,1、使用
ps
命令,,
ps
命令是Linux系统中用于查看进程状态的常用命令,通过这个命令,我们可以查看到当前系统中所有正在运行的进程信息。,基本语法:,常用选项:,
a
:显示所有用户的进程信息,
u
:以用户为主的进程状态格式显示,
x
:显示没有控制终端的进程,
e
:显示环境变量,
f
:显示完整格式的进程状态,
r
:显示运行中的进程,
s
:显示进程状态,
t
:显示进程和终端的关联,
T
:显示当前终端下的进程,
u
:以用户为主的进程状态格式显示,
x
:显示没有控制终端的进程,,
e
:显示环境变量,
f
:显示完整格式的进程状态,
r
:显示运行中的进程,
s
:显示进程状态,
t
:显示进程和终端的关联,
T
:显示当前终端下的进程,要查看所有用户的进程信息,可以使用以下命令:,2、使用
top
命令,
top
命令是一个实时动态地查看系统进程状态的命令,它会实时显示系统中各个进程的资源占用情况,如CPU、内存等,通过这个命令,我们可以实时监控正在运行的程序。,基本语法:,常用选项:,
d
:设置刷新间隔,单位为秒,默认为3秒,
p
:根据CPU使用率进行排序,默认为按照CPU使用率从高到低排序,
u
:根据内存使用率进行排序,默认为按照内存使用率从高到低排序,,
n
:设置刷新次数,默认为无限次刷新,
q
:退出top命令,要以CPU使用率进行排序并实时刷新,可以使用以下命令:,3、使用
htop
命令(需要安装),
htop
是一个比
top
更人性化的命令行进程查看器,它提供了更多的功能和更好的界面,使得查看和管理进程更加方便,需要注意的是,
htop
不是Linux系统的默认安装包,需要单独安装。,基本语法:,常用选项与
top
类似,这里不再赘述,安装方法可以参考其他教程。,4、使用
pgrep
命令和
pkill
命令(需要安装),
pgrep
命令用于查找符合条件的进程ID,而
pkill
命令用于根据进程ID杀死进程,这两个命令通常结合使用,以便更方便地管理进程,需要注意的是,这两个命令也需要单独安装。,基本语法:,要查找名为”firefox”的进程ID,可以使用以下命令:,“`php<?php pgrep firefox ?><?php pkill firefox ?>
linux怎么查正在运行的程序
版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《linux怎么查正在运行的程序》
文章链接:https://zhuji.vsping.com/491910.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。
文章名称:《linux怎么查正在运行的程序》
文章链接:https://zhuji.vsping.com/491910.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。